Now I know I might be a bit thick on 13:58 - Mar 24 with 2469 views | itfcjoe | A combination of people buying one and never using it, to give them more room. Or buying one and not using it which they can then upgrade for big games to an adult ticket so their mate can sit next to them. Either way, I'm not sure 'abuse' is the right term, far from it, and that latest reply to Funge is ridiculous. They could simply have not allowed these tickets to be upgraded, and asked others why they aren't being used to actually find out rather than punish everyone. Sledgehammer to crack a nut, that may not even need to be cracked. | |
